<p n="1023">hitherto been made for their Support by the Publick Notwithstanding they are in<lb></lb>
themselves the most helpless and Deplorable objects of Charity and to their<lb></lb>
Neighbours most Expensive and Dangerous; Upon these Considerations the<lb></lb>
Governors of Bethlem Hospital (Ever ready to Promote Acts of Charity) made<lb></lb>
Application to the Mayor Comonalty and Citizens of the City of London for<lb></lb>
a Grant of a Price of Ground in Moorfeilds (Part wherof was a Common<lb></lb>
Footway) in Order to Build Appartments for Harbouring One hundred<lb></lb>
Incurable Lunatick Half men & half Women which Grant they have lately<lb></lb>
Obtained; and they have also obtained His Majestys Royal License for<lb></lb>
Inclosing the said Foot way for the Purpose aforesaid And have began to<lb></lb>
Build thereon out of some Benefaction already Given for that Use: But the<lb></lb>
said Governors cannot Perfect the same & raise a Fund for the Maintenance<lb></lb>
of such Incurable Lunaticks and necessary Attendants without the Assistance<lb></lb>
of well Disposed Persons Now Therefore Well whose Names are hereunto<lb></lb>
Subscribed have Voluntarily Contributed and paid the Several Sumes of<lb></lb>
money by us respectively Underwritten for and towards the Advancing and<lb></lb>
Carrying on of a Charity so great and well Designed Hoping that they<lb></lb>
who Enjoy the Blessing of a Right mind, will lend their Assistance to them<lb></lb>
who are ever like to Want itThis Court Approved thereof And<lb></lb>
it is Order'd that the same to Advertized in the News Papers in such<lb></lb>
manner as Mr. Treasurer shall think fittAnd that the said Book<lb></lb>
be kept by Mr. Treasurer & that two Copys be made thereof One to bye<lb></lb>
at Bridewell & the others at Bethlem Hospital</p>
